Esports Scholarships Expand at Colleges and Universities Across Europe and North America

The esports industry has evolved from garage-based tournaments to a billion-dollar movement, and universities are taking notice. Leading universities throughout North America and Europe now offer competitive scholarships to skilled players, viewing esports as a valid competitive pursuit. Expansion of Esports Programs in Higher Education

The development of esports programs in universities demonstrates a notable transformation in how colleges and universities view professional gaming. Over the past five years, hundreds of colleges and universities across both North America and Europe have created esports departments and competitive teams. This expansion demonstrates the industry’s maturation and the recognition that esports constitutes a valid competitive field worthy of institutional support and academic investment.

Universities are dedicating significant resources to develop competitive esports infrastructures, including dedicated gaming spaces, advanced gaming hardware, and expert coaching teams. Institutions like the UC system and universities across Europe have committed substantial funding in state-of-the-art esports arenas featuring specialized gaming systems, high-speed network infrastructure, and audience viewing areas. These spaces rival professional esports venues, demonstrating universities’ dedication to providing elite training facilities for student competitors.

The evolving landscape has escalated as universities attract top-tier talent with full-scale scholarship packages. Complete scholarship awards now include tuition, housing, and day-to-day costs for elite players, making esports recruitment similar to traditional athletic scholarships. This increased professionalization in university esports has attracted serious competitors who formerly pursued professional gaming independently, fundamentally transforming campus culture and athlete-student demographics.

Financial Support and Educational Standards

Monetary aid through esports scholarships varies significantly among universities, with many programs providing generous funding to recruit top-tier talent. Comprehensive scholarship packages cover tuition, room, board, and sometimes additional stipends for gear and travel costs. Limited scholarships provide targeted support for particular expenses, enabling universities to support more players. These commitments demonstrate universities’ commitment to building competitive programs while ensuring fiscal responsibility and accessibility for varied student groups.

Academic requirements continue to be essential to esports scholarship programs, guaranteeing student-athletes juggle competitive pursuits with educational goals. Most universities mandate minimum GPA standards, typically between 2.5 and 3.0, and demand steady progress academically for scholarship renewal. Students must maintain enrollment status and participate in classes consistently. These requirements reflect institutional values prioritizing education with competition, preparing esports athletes for post-gaming careers through thorough academic growth and professional development programs.

Difficulties and Future Direction

Despite accelerated development, esports scholarships confront major obstacles that universities must manage strategically. Apprehension over gaming addiction, mental health impacts, and the sustainability of esports careers continue among academic institutions. Additionally, creating consistent admission requirements and certification across different regions proves challenging, as each country upholds distinct regulations. Universities must reconcile competitive excellence with scholarly excellence, guaranteeing students receive quality education in conjunction with esports training and support services.

Looking ahead, the esports scholarship landscape looks promising yet uncertain. Industry experts predict continued expansion as more institutions acknowledge competitive gaming’s validity and business prospects. However, success hinges on resolving present issues through comprehensive player welfare programs, mental wellness programs, and career pathway opportunities. Universities that invest in holistic athlete support systems while upholding academic requirements will likely lead the sector, positioning esports as a legitimate field within higher education.
